Optimal mid lane champion to play in higher ranks?

In lower divisions, Ryze and Talyah are being seen as "troll picks", now in middle of Platinum i am finding it hard to keep up with playing Lux, ESPECIALLY versus Ryze. His damage is just a living nightmare. But anyways, i am trying to ask high elo players, what is the best mid lane champion to play? Should i stop playing Lux for Ahri? Or the other way around? I need some help. {{sticker:sg-lux-2}}
